How are Kellogg's Special K and Kellogg's Honey Smacks Cereal different?

  • Kellogg's Special K is higher than Kellogg's Honey Smacks Cereal in Vitamin B12, Vitamin B6, Iron, Folate, Vitamin E , Vitamin C, Selenium, Vitamin B2, Vitamin B3, and Vitamin B1.
  • Kellogg's Special K covers your daily need of Vitamin B12 575% more than Kellogg's Honey Smacks Cereal.
  • Kellogg's Special K contains 37 times more Vitamin E than Kellogg's Honey Smacks Cereal. Kellogg's Special K contains 15.3mg of Vitamin E , while Kellogg's Honey Smacks Cereal contains 0.41mg.

Cereals ready-to-eat, KELLOGG, KELLOGG'S SPECIAL K and Cereals ready-to-eat, KELLOGG, KELLOGG'S HONEY SMACKS types were used in this article.

All nutrients comparison - raw data values

Nutrient Kellogg's Special K Kellogg's Honey Smacks Cereal Opinion
Net carbs 72g 83.5g Kellogg's Honey Smacks Cereal
Protein 17.79g 5.7g Kellogg's Special K
Fats 1.79g 2.2g Kellogg's Honey Smacks Cereal
Carbs 73.4g 88.5g Kellogg's Honey Smacks Cereal
Calories 377kcal 380kcal Kellogg's Honey Smacks Cereal
Sugar 12.69g 56.2g Kellogg's Special K
Fiber 1.4g 5g Kellogg's Honey Smacks Cereal
Calcium 23mg 14mg Kellogg's Special K
Iron 28mg 1.5mg Kellogg's Special K
Magnesium 12mg 59mg Kellogg's Honey Smacks Cereal
Phosphorus 48mg 213mg Kellogg's Honey Smacks Cereal
Potassium 53mg 183mg Kellogg's Honey Smacks Cereal
Sodium 667mg 142mg Kellogg's Honey Smacks Cereal
Zinc 0.69mg 1.7mg Kellogg's Honey Smacks Cereal
Copper 0.179mg 0.195mg Kellogg's Honey Smacks Cereal
Manganese 1.895mg Kellogg's Honey Smacks Cereal
Selenium 54.9µg 29.1µg Kellogg's Special K
Vitamin A 1667IU 1852IU Kellogg's Honey Smacks Cereal
Vitamin A RAE 500µg 556µg Kellogg's Honey Smacks Cereal
Vitamin E 15.3mg 0.41mg Kellogg's Special K
Vitamin D 134IU 148IU Kellogg's Honey Smacks Cereal
Vitamin D 3.3µg 3.7µg Kellogg's Honey Smacks Cereal
Vitamin C 68mg 22mg Kellogg's Special K
Vitamin B1 1.69mg 1.39mg Kellogg's Special K
Vitamin B2 1.91mg 1.57mg Kellogg's Special K
Vitamin B3 22.6mg 18.5mg Kellogg's Special K
Vitamin B6 6.44mg 1.85mg Kellogg's Special K
Folate 1290µg 370µg Kellogg's Special K
Vitamin B12 19.4µg 5.6µg Kellogg's Special K
Vitamin K 0.1µg 2.8µg Kellogg's Honey Smacks Cereal
Trans Fat 0g 0.5g Kellogg's Special K
Saturated Fat 0.4g 0.5g Kellogg's Special K
Monounsaturated Fat 0.3g 0.4g Kellogg's Honey Smacks Cereal
Polyunsaturated fat 0.4g 0.5g Kellogg's Honey Smacks Cereal
